NYRR Celebrates Pride Month and the 40th Running of the Pride Run
LGBT Pride Month is celebrated every June as a tribute to those involved in the Stonewall uprising of 1969, which is widely considered the start of the modern LGBT rights movement in the U.S. Pride Month also celebrates LGBTQIA+ pride and the ongoing movement toward equality, diversity, and inclusiveness.
For NYRR, June is the month of the Front Runners New York LGBT Pride Run, which will have its 40th running this year as a 6K on June 26 in Central Park. The race is a partnership between NYRR and Front Runners New York, and this year includes the Virtual Front Runners New York LGBT Pride Run 5K from June 25 through June 30.
